伊春当我开始接触Android开发时,我被这个充满无限可能的世界深深吸引。Android开发,简而言之,就是为运行Android操作系统的设备创建应用程序的过程。这些设备包括智能手机、平板电脑、智能手表,甚至是电视和汽车。Android作为一个开源平台,它允许开发者自由地探索、创新和构建各种应用程序,满足用户的需求。
Android开发的重要性不言而喻。随着智能手机的普及,Android操作系统已经成为全球最广泛使用的移动操作系统之一。对于企业来说,拥有一个Android应用可以扩大他们的市场覆盖范围,提高品牌知名度。对于个人开发者而言,Android开发提供了一个展示才华、实现创意的平台。此外,Android开发还为开发者提供了一个稳定的职业道路,因为对Android应用的需求一直在增长。
伊春通过Android开发,我们可以构建出既实用又有趣的应用,改善人们的生活质量。无论是提高工作效率的工具应用,还是娱乐休闲的游戏应用,Android开发都扮演着至关重要的角色。随着技术的不断进步,Android开发也在不断地发展和完善,为开发者提供了更多的工具和资源,以创造出更加出色的应用。
伊春谈到Android开发,就不得不提Android Studio。Android Studio是一个官方的集成开发环境(IDE),专为Android应用开发而设计。它提供了一套完整的工具,帮助我高效地编写代码、调试应用,并最终构建出高质量的Android应用。Android Studio集成了代码编辑器、调试器、性能分析工具等,让我可以一站式完成所有开发任务。
在Android Studio中,我可以使用它强大的代码自动补全功能,这大大加快了我的编码速度。此外,它还提供了实时代码检查和快速修复建议,帮助我及时发现并修正潜在的错误。Android Studio还内置了版本控制系统,如Git,让我可以轻松地管理代码变更和团队协作。
伊春
伊春选择Android Studio作为我的开发工具,是因为它拥有许多无可比拟的优势。首先,它是完全免费的,并且由Google官方支持,这意味着我总能获得最新的功能更新和安全补丁。其次,Android Studio拥有庞大的插件生态系统,我可以根据需要安装各种插件来扩展其功能,比如代码格式化、性能分析等。
此外,Android Studio提供了出色的调试支持,我可以在模拟器或真实设备上运行应用,并使用它强大的调试工具来跟踪问题。它还支持多种屏幕尺寸和分辨率的模拟,让我可以确保应用在不同设备上都能提供良好的用户体验。总之,Android Studio以其强大的功能、灵活性和易用性,成为了我开发Android应用的首选工具。
伊春
开始下载Android Studio的第一步,当然是要访问它的官方网站。我通常会在浏览器中输入网址,直接跳转到Android Studio的官方下载页面。这个页面不仅提供了下载链接,还有关于软件的详细信息和最新动态,这对于我了解当前版本的功能和修复的bug非常有帮助。
伊春
在官网上,下载链接非常明显,通常位于页面的中心或顶部。点击下载按钮后,会引导我选择适合我操作系统的安装包。无论是Windows、macOS还是Linux,Android Studio都提供了相应的安装版本,这让我无论使用哪种操作系统,都能轻松开始开发工作。
伊春在下载Android Studio之前,了解系统要求是非常重要的一步。这可以确保我在安装过程中不会遇到兼容性问题,也能让开发环境运行得更加流畅。
伊春
伊春对于操作系统,Android Studio支持最新的Windows 10、macOS和Linux发行版。这意味着只要我的操作系统保持更新,就可以放心下载和安装Android Studio。当然,我也需要确保操作系统的版本不是太旧,以免出现兼容性问题。
在硬件方面,Android Studio需要一定的配置来保证良好的开发体验。至少需要2GB的RAM,但我建议使用4GB或更多,以便在运行模拟器或处理大型项目时不会感到卡顿。此外,至少需要2GB的可用磁盘空间来安装Android Studio和后续的SDK,但考虑到项目文件和缓存,更大的磁盘空间总是更好的。对于处理器,虽然官方没有明确说明,但一个较快的多核处理器无疑会提升开发效率。
伊春综上所述,只要我的计算机满足这些基本要求,就可以顺利下载并安装Android Studio,开始我的Android开发之旅了。
伊春
伊春下载完成后,我迫不及待地想要开始安装Android Studio。双击下载的安装文件,安装向导就会启动。这个向导非常友好,它会一步步引导我完成安装过程。首先,它会提示我阅读并接受用户协议,这是开始安装前的必要步骤。我仔细阅读了协议内容,确认无误后,便点击了“同意”按钮,继续进行下一步。
伊春
接下来,向导会让我选择安装路径。我通常会选择默认路径,因为它已经设置好了最适合大多数用户的位置。但如果你有特殊的需求,比如想要节省C盘空间,也可以选择自定义安装路径。只要确保选择的磁盘有足够的空间,就可以避免安装过程中出现问题。
伊春在选择了安装路径后,向导会显示一个总结页面,让我再次确认所有的设置。我仔细检查了一遍,确认无误后,便点击了“安装”按钮。安装过程非常迅速,几分钟后,Android Studio就安装完成了。向导最后会提示我是否要启动Android Studio,我毫不犹豫地选择了“是”,因为我已经迫不及待想要开始我的开发之旅了。
伊春
伊春首次启动Android Studio,它会进行一些初始化设置,比如导入示例项目和配置开发环境。这个过程可能会花费一些时间,但我可以利用这个时间来阅读Android Studio的欢迎界面,了解一些基本的功能和快捷键。这些信息对于提高开发效率非常有帮助。
初始化设置完成后,我需要配置Android SDK的路径。Android Studio会自动检测到我系统中已安装的SDK,但我也可以手动添加或更改SDK路径。我点击了“Configure”按钮,然后选择了“SDK Manager”。在这里,我可以浏览和管理所有的SDK版本,选择我需要的版本进行安装或更新。配置好SDK路径后,我的Android Studio就完全准备好了,可以开始开发项目了。
通过以上步骤,我成功地安装并配置了Android Studio。现在,我已经迫不及待地想要开始我的Android开发之旅了。Android Studio的强大功能和便捷操作,让我对接下来的开发工作充满了期待。
伊春在我安装好Android Studio之后,我发现了一个非常强大的工具——SDK Manager。这个工具可以说是Android开发中的核心,因为它负责管理我们开发过程中需要的所有SDK(Software Development Kit)。通过SDK Manager,我可以下载不同版本的Android SDK,这对于开发不同版本的应用来说至关重要。此外,它还能帮助我更新现有的SDK,确保我使用的是最新的API和工具。
伊春
伊春
开始下载SDK之前,我需要确定我需要哪些版本的Android SDK。SDK Manager提供了一个清晰的列表,显示了所有可用的Android版本。我可以根据我的项目需求,选择下载最新版本的SDK,或者是为了兼容性考虑,下载一些旧版本的SDK。这个选择过程非常直观,我只需要勾选我需要的版本,然后点击“下载”按钮。
一旦我选择了需要的SDK版本,SDK Manager就会开始下载和安装这些包。这个过程可能会根据我的网络速度和选择的SDK大小而有所不同。在下载过程中,我可以看到每个包的下载进度,这让我可以实时监控安装过程。完成下载后,SDK Manager会自动安装这些包,我只需要等待安装完成,就可以开始使用这些SDK进行开发了。
伊春
伊春随着Android系统的不断更新,新的API和功能也在不断推出。因此,定期更新SDK是非常重要的。SDK Manager提供了一个简单的更新功能,我可以在这里查看所有已安装的SDK,并选择需要更新的版本。点击“更新”按钮后,SDK Manager会自动下载并安装最新的SDK包,确保我的开发环境始终保持最新。
伊春
有时候,我可能会下载一些我实际上并不需要的SDK版本。SDK Manager允许我轻松管理这些SDK,包括卸载它们以节省磁盘空间。我只需要在SDK Manager中选择不再需要的SDK版本,然后点击“卸载”按钮,就可以从我的系统中移除这些不再使用的SDK包。这样,我就可以保持我的开发环境整洁,并且只保留我真正需要的工具和资源。
通过SDK Manager,我可以轻松地下载、更新和管理Android SDK,这对于我的Android开发工作来说是一个巨大的帮助。它让我能够专注于编码,而不必担心环境配置的问题。
伊春在使用Android Studio进行开发的过程中,我发现了一个能够极大提升工作效率的秘密武器——插件。这些插件就像是给Android Studio添加的超能力,它们可以扩展IDE的功能,让我的开发过程更加流畅和高效。无论是代码编辑、性能分析还是版本控制,都能找到相应的插件来辅助我。插件的作用不可小觑,它们能够让我专注于创意和编码,而不是被繁琐的任务所困扰。
伊春
伊春
伊春想要给我的Android Studio添加新功能,我首先需要访问插件市场。Android Studio内置了一个插件市场,我可以直接从IDE中访问。这个市场提供了大量的插件,涵盖了从代码质量检查到设计辅助的各个方面。我只需要在Android Studio中找到“设置”或“首选项”菜单,然后选择“插件”选项,就可以打开插件市场,开始浏览和搜索我需要的插件了。
伊春一旦我在插件市场中找到了心仪的插件,安装过程非常简单。我只需要点击插件旁边的“安装”按钮,Android Studio就会自动下载并安装插件。安装完成后,通常需要重启IDE来启用新插件。重启后,我就可以在我的项目中使用这些新功能了。有些插件可能需要在设置中进行额外的配置,以确保它们能够按照我的预期工作。
伊春
在代码编辑方面,我特别推荐几个插件。首先是“Android ButterKnife Zelezny”,它能够自动生成ButterKnife的绑定代码,大大减少了我手动编写绑定代码的时间。另一个是“Lombok Plugin”,它通过注解的方式,帮我自动生成模板代码,如getters、setters等,让我的代码更加简洁。这些插件让我的编码工作变得更加轻松,也减少了出错的可能性。
对于性能分析,我推荐使用“Android Profiler”插件。这个插件集成在Android Studio中,可以让我直接在IDE中监控应用的性能,包括CPU、内存、网络和电池使用情况。通过这个工具,我可以实时查看应用的性能数据,并进行优化。此外,“Matisse”插件也是一个不错的选择,它提供了一个简单易用的图片选择器,让我在开发过程中能够快速处理图片资源。
伊春通过这些插件的辅助,我的Android Studio变得更加强大,它们不仅提高了我的开发效率,还帮助我产出更高质量的代码。插件的选择和使用,让我能够更加专注于创造,而不是被技术细节所束缚。
扫描二维码推送至手机访问。
版权声明:本文由顺沃网络-小程序开发-网站建设-app开发发布,如需转载请注明出处。
在数字化时代,软件和应用程序已经成为我们日常生活和商业运作中不可或缺的一部分。无论是个人还是企业,我们都在寻找能够满足特定需求的工具。这就是软件app开发定制公司发挥作用的地方。我今天想聊聊为什么选择定制开发公司对企业和个人来说至关重要。 1.1 软件app开发定制公司的重要性 想象一下,如果你的业...
1.1 什么是软件开发定制 软件开发定制,对我来说,就像是量身定做一件衣服。它是一种根据客户特定需求来设计和开发软件的过程。这种定制化的服务意味着软件不仅仅是通用的解决方案,而是完全符合企业或个人独特需求的工具。想象一下,你走进一家服装店,告诉裁缝你想要的风格、颜色和尺寸,然后他们为你制作出独一无二...
在当今这个数字化时代,软件制作开发公司扮演着至关重要的角色。它们不仅仅是技术的提供者,更是推动商业创新和数字化转型的关键力量。我深信,没有这些公司,我们的世界将无法享受到如今便捷、高效的服务和产品。 1.1 软件制作开发公司的重要性 软件制作开发公司的重要性不言而喻。它们是现代商业的基石,为各行各业...
在数字化时代,软件定制开发平台软件已经成为企业提升竞争力、优化业务流程的重要工具。那么,什么是软件定制开发平台软件呢?简单来说,它是一种可以根据特定需求定制开发软件的平台,它允许企业根据自己的业务需求,设计和开发出独一无二的软件解决方案。 1.1 软件定制开发平台软件的定义 软件定制开发平台软件,就...
在软件开发的世界里,权威机构扮演着至关重要的角色。这些机构不仅定义了行业的标准,还确保了软件产品的质量与安全性。今天,我想和大家聊聊这些权威机构的定义、作用以及它们对软件开发行业的影响。 1.1 权威机构的定义与作用 权威机构,顾名思义,就是那些在特定领域内具有权威性的组织。在软件开发领域,这些机构...
在当今这个数字化时代,企业级移动应用已经成为企业运营不可或缺的一部分。它们不仅改变了我们工作的方式,还极大地提高了效率和生产力。作为一名企业主,我深切地感受到了移动应用在提升业务流程、增强客户互动以及优化内部管理中的关键作用。 1.1 企业级移动应用的重要性 企业级移动应用的重要性不言而喻。它们帮助...